The Patriots are re-signing their lone restricted free agent.

According to Mike Reiss of ESPNBoston.com, the Patriots have reached a one-year deal with long-snapper Danny Aiken.

A Virginia product, the 25-year-old Aiken has been the Patriots’ long-snapper since 2011. He was credited with five special teams tackles in 2013.

Terms of Aiken’s deal are not known, but it’s probably reasonable to assume he will be re-signed to an amount lower than the lowest RFA tender.
